Honestly I am glad it is now been revealed that Paul Rudd will indeed be Ant-Man because I think the guy is a great actor, both comedic (of course) and surprisingly dramatic. For anyone who has seen Our Idiot Brother or some of his more emotional scenes in Friends you’ll know what I'm talking about. The guy has done well for himself and I think moving into a mainstream blockbuster role is the natural progression for him.

Paul Rudd being a comedic actor he should be able to portray Ant-Man in a very self-aware way. The character of Ant-Man is somewhat ridiculous and will of course be difficult to translate to the big screen. They needed an actor who can play the character very likeable and slightly tongue-in-cheek because otherwise, why would someone bother with Ant-Man when there are characters like Thor and Iron Man around? Paul Rudd’s Ant-Man I’m sure will be vastly different from anything we’ve seen before in this universe. I love the idea of this comedic actor, who is entirely capable in terms delivering fair dramatic performances playing a character as ludicrous as Ant-Man.


On a side note, Edgar Wright is a fine choice for directing duties and is of course excellent at working with comedians. I can see Paul Rudd and Edgar Wright working well together and I think Ant-Man will set a good platform and tone for Marvel’s Phase 3 coming 2015.
